What is the salary of a Detentions Deputy? In the United States, a Detentions Deputy earns an average salary of $86,695. The salary range for a Detentions Deputy is usually between $65,539 and $95,900 per year, representing the 25th to 75th percentiles respectively. The top 10% of earners, that is the 90th percentile, have an annual salary of $100,284. The highest Detentions Deputy salary in the United States was $114,484. The average hourly pay for a Detentions Deputy is $41.68.
